Output 64db500a1706498d08eb18c30868b5077fa4cbee6743e0f52e5ff3ea21c341aa:100

value
92191
script pubkey
OP_0 OP_PUSHBYTES_20 cd7501df8dd9d549d8c6049b3dc58afaaad861df
address
bc1qe46srhudm825nkxxqjdnm3v2l24dscwlqjvaq7
transaction
64db500a1706498d08eb18c30868b5077fa4cbee6743e0f52e5ff3ea21c341aa
spent
true